Purpose:
The Undergraduate Admission Counselor is responsible for various individual and team activities related to the recruitment, review, and advisement of prerequisites, evaluation of official transcript credit, and admitting undergraduate students to achieve University enrollment and net revenue goals. This includes meeting with students, families and other constituents to provide them with general information about the University and the requirements for admission. The position provides administrative oversight of the admission funnel, and uses discretion and independent judgment regarding meeting prerequisites, and making the admission decision.


Duties:

  • Building relationships to effectively recruit high school, transfer, and adult students through the inquiry and application funnels 
  • Conduct admission interviews
  • Perform accurate and comprehensive transfer credit evaluations
  • Execute communication plans via phone, email, and text
  • Embrace the utilization of technological resources, including social media
  • Review applicants
  • Make admission decisions
  • Make scholarship recommendations
  • Develop and manage a recruiting territory
  • Communicate and build relationships with prospective students, guidance counselors, community college counselors, and other personnel related to the assigned territory
  • Moderate travel is required in the Fall and Spring of each year
  • Some evening and weekend responsibilities will be required 
  • Organization of Campus visits, group visits, open house programs, and related campus activities for prospective students, parents, and guidance counselors
  • Research and implement recruitment opportunities both on and off-campus
  • Represent the University at various events and speaking engagements
  • Work collaboratively with academic departments and support services in order to plan and recruit at on and off-campus events, including open houses and information sessions.
  • Serve on committees within the Mount and externally when applicable
  • Other duties as assigned
